Poulenc’s witty Concerto for Two Pianos features 2006 Gilmore Artist Ingrid Fliter and Venezuelan-born pianist Vanessa Perez with the Gilmore Festival Chamber Orchestra, comprising members of the Kalamazoo and Grand Rapids Symphonies. Poulenc’s three-movement dazzler of a concerto has influences ranging from Mozart to Balinese Gamelan sounds. Fliter and Perez will also perform individually in works for piano and orchestra by Chopin and Haydn, and the concert will include the clever and charming Octet of Igor Stravinsky.
